Skincare:

Caudalie Make-Up Remover Cleansing Water*

I absolutely fell in love with this product. It was so soft and gentle - yet still super effective at removing every last trace of make-up. I especially liked the scent too. I'd rate it ahead of the Bioderma for sure.

Lancôme Bi-Facial Non Oily Instant Cleanser For Sensitive Eyes

I picked this up at the airport in duty free and I'm so glad I did because I've long been on the hunt for the perfect eye make-up remover. This completely removes eye make-up but it does it so effortlessly - without pulling at delicate skin around my eyes.

La Roche Posay Effaclar Duo+*

I've heard loads of good stuff about this from bloggers and friends so I reached for it straight away when I had a breakout. It definitely helped clear my skin up but it's too harsh for everyday use so I'll just be using it every time I see a spot forming.

Clarins Beauty Flash Balm

It's not often I have good skin days - most of the time I wake up to a nasty breakout and I use the heaviest concealer I can find to cover it up. But when I do have good skin, I use this. It gives my skin a lovely, natural glow that just looks really fresh faced and healthy. LOVE.

Make-up:

Liz Earle Radiant Glow Bronzer* + Avon Powder Brush

I've turned my back on heavy contouring - recently I've been really favouring a natural looking bronzed look instead. I swirl the big, fluffy brush around this bronzer and apply it all over my face, focusing on the temples and cheeks. It makes me look awake, healthy and ready for the day.

No7 Clear Brow Gel

Going with the more natural look, I've been ditching the eyebrow pencils and powders for this clear gel instead. It makes me feel polished without looking too overdone.

MAC Mineralize Charged Water Skin Hydrating Mist

Normally, my Urban Decay B6 Spray is my fixing spray of choice, but I ran out of that so I've been using this instead. I love the fresh feeling it gives me as I spray it onto my face first thing (before I apply make-up) but I also feel like it keeps everything in place after I've applied it all.

Haircare:

Dove Hair Therapy Leave-In Conditioning & Care Spray

I didn't have massive expectations for this because it was only a few quid from Boots - but my expectations were MASSIVELY surpassed after I used it. I spray it all over towel-dried locks and comb it through - it leaves my hair feeling so soft and silky. I'd repurchase it in a heartbeat.

Palmer's Cocoa Butter Formula Shampoo and Conditioner*

I'm a massive chocoholic so I jumped at the chance to try this cocoa-scented shampoo and conditioner. I'm not a massive fan of mint but this smells like chocolate mint and it's just delicious! I would eat it if I could.

Schwarzkopf got2be 2 Sexy Big Volume Push Up Volumizing Hairspray

I'm a BIG fan of L'Oreal Elnett but this might have just tested my loyalty. I used it when I was a bridesmaid at my friend's wedding and it kept my curly locks in place all day. It also smells amazing and comes in a MASSIVE bottle.
